    Re: Should I get YES for 150 yahama carb? (JOHN202)

    I will say, that you are probably looking at one of the most bullet proof outboards (150 VMax carb) that ANY outboard manufacturer EVER built.
    Run quaility oil in her ( preferably 100% synthetic after breakin), and add Seafoam to EVERY gallon of gas ya use in her, and she last a LOOOOOOOOOOOOONG time!
    If buying new, I would get what warranty comes with it (and like above post says, there may be a "free" incentive program going on right now) and not purchase any extended. Spend that Xtra money on equipment for the boat!
